    Note: ProXPN, unfortunately, no longer offers its VPN services. While it’s out of the race, the battle between IVPN and VPN Unlimited is white hot, which is why we’ll compare them for you below.

    IVPN is a mid-tier VPN that’s known for punching above its weight in terms of providing a solid, private, and secure VPN service. VPN Unlimted is a top-tier provider but hasn’t gained the same popularity as some of the most prominent VPN names. Both companies have also taken drastically different approaches toward their VPN offerings, making for an interesting comparison.

    VPN Unlimited is headquartered in the US, one of the founding members of the 5 Eyes Alliance. IVPN, on the other hand, is based in Gibraltar, which, although a British territory, provides greater protection against the disclosure of user information.

    With 3,000 servers across 56 countries, VPN Unlimited has an elite-level global server network. IVPN has a much smaller network, but its coverage includes most regions.

    In terms of features, VPN Unlimited went all out. It offers 6 secure VPN protocols, a password vault, and other add-on security tools. IVPN stuck with highly effective capabilities to keep your online activity private, like multi-hop and a tracker blocker.

    Both have affordable and flexible pricing options and back their services with money-back guarantees. While IVPN offers a 1-week plan and cheaper short-term pricing, VPN Unlimited is one of the only VPNs with a lifetime plan.

    Best VPN for Torrents

    While none of these are our top picks for torrenting, IVPN is the best of the bunch. VPN Unlimited has a significantly larger server network, but only 3 locations are available for torrenting, and their connection speeds tend to be slow. Both also discourage torrenting using US servers, but only VPN Unlimited has a tendency to throttle P2P file sharing. It also has multi-hop, which makes it harder to trace your IP. The AntiTracker tool will help keep your experience ad and malware-free when torrenting. The Pro plan has port forwarding to potentially speed up downloads.

    Best VPN for Windows

    Most VPN users will love how clean and easy to navigate the IVPN Windows app is. It has a flat navigational structure, allowing you to choose a server from the map while toggling settings on and off using the lefthand menu. It comes with WireGuard or OpenVPN support, a kill switch, split tunneling, and Wi-Fi rules. So, it’s everything you expect in a top VPN.

    Best VPN for Android

    VPN Unlimited clearly offers a superior app for Android. It supports 6 different VPN protocols, versus IVPN’s 2. It also has a kill switch, which IVPN lacks. While IVPN’s Android has most other features, this is an important security vulnerability and a feature we’d like to see added soon. The network whitelister will also help protect you from unknown, unsecured Wi-Fi networks.

    Best VPN for Mac

    Both VPN Unlimited and IVPN offer macOS apps that are nearly identical to their Windows versions. Neither lacks any important features and has modern, ultra-usable designs. It should be a draw, but we’ll give it to IVPN because we still prefer its all-in-one dashboard.

    Best VPN for iOS

    VPN Unlimited’s iOS app beats IVPN for many of the same reasons as the Android app. It also supports all 6 protocols and has a kill switch, both of which are rare among VPN apps for iOS. It has an exceptional 4.6-star rating on the Apple App Store, which shows just how high most users regard it.

    Best VPN for USA

    IVPN is the best option for users in the US by some margin. Despite having fewer servers overall, it has almost double the US servers VPN Unlimited has. The company is also not based in the US, so the chance that you’ll be impacted by DMCA actions is much smaller. That being said, VPN Unlimited is the better gateway to access international content with servers in over 56 countries.
